Kid Rock, like Mike Tyson and Tom Cruise, should never say no to an interview. While Tyson and Cruise are great quotes because they're crazy, Kid Rock is great because he says stuff like this: "I do not believe that artists or actors and people should be out there like voicing their full-blown opinions on politics because, let's face it, at the end of the day, I'm not that smart of a guy." True, but you are a damn good musician, Bob Ritchie. See Mr. Rock 6 p.m. Friday at the Smirnoff Music Centre, 1818 First Ave. in Dallas. Tickets are $19.75 to $43.75.
